The choker chains that came with my Fransgard logwinch are really nice. A slip link on one end and a "needle" on the other. Can't find similar anywhere. They're also smaller than 5/16", maybe 1/4", but must be high grade steel and plated. Strong and light, so I can lug all 3 to the logs while pulling the cable out.
